母体有机氯农药残留对婴儿的影响。

Effects of Organochlorine Pesticide Residues in Maternal Body on Infants.

Abstract

There are many organochlorine pollutants in the environment, which can be directly or indirectly exposed to by mothers, and as estrogen endocrine disruptors can cause damage to the lactation capacity of the mammary gland. In addition, because breast milk contains a lot of nutrients, it is the most important food source for new-born babies. If mothers are exposed to organochlorine pesticides (OCPs), the lipophilic organochlorine contaminants can accumulate in breast milk fat and be passed to the infant through breast milk. Therefore, it is necessary to investigate organochlorine contaminants in human milk to estimate the health risks of these contaminants to breastfed infants. In addition, toxic substances in the mother can also be passed to the fetus through the placenta, which is also something we need to pay attention to. This article introduces several types of OCPs, such as dichlorodiphenyltrichloroethane (DDT), methoxychlor (MXC), hexachlorocyclohexane (HCH), endosulfan, chlordane, heptachlorand and hexachlorobenzene (HCB), mainly expounds their effects on women's lactation ability and infant health, and provides reference for maternal and infant health. In addition, some measures and methods for the control of organochlorine pollutants are also described here.

摘要

环境中存在许多有机氯污染物,这些污染物可以通过母亲直接或间接暴露,并且作为雌激素内分泌干扰物会对乳腺的泌乳能力造成损害。此外,由于母乳含有大量营养物质,它是新生儿最重要的食物来源。如果母亲接触有机氯农药 (OCPs),亲脂性有机氯污染物会在母乳脂肪中蓄积,并通过母乳传递给婴儿。因此,有必要调查人乳中的有机氯污染物,以评估这些污染物对母乳喂养婴儿的健康风险。此外,母亲体内的有毒物质也可以通过胎盘传递给胎儿,这也是我们需要注意的问题。本文介绍了几种 OCPs,如滴滴涕 (DDT)、甲氧滴滴涕 (MXC)、六氯环己烷 (HCH)、硫丹、氯丹、七氯和六氯苯 (HCB),主要阐述了它们对女性泌乳能力和婴儿健康的影响,为母婴健康提供参考。此外,本文还介绍了一些控制有机氯污染物的措施和方法。
